爬虫python
爬虫python
2025-04-26 07:35
Python爬虫:自动收集数据的利器,利用Python编写,快速高效处理网络资源。
标题: 爬虫 Python
![]()
在我们日常生活和工作中,有时候我们需要处理大量的数据和信息。如果有一个便捷的方式能够收集数据,并且有效地分析和使用,这将会是一个极佳的辅助工具。此时,Python爬虫就显得非常重要。接下来我们将简要地了解一下爬虫 Python 的一些基础知识和实践技巧。
![]()
一、什么是Python爬虫?
![]()
简单来说,爬虫就是一个可以自动浏览网站,并将感兴趣的信息自动下载的计算机程序。这种技术被称为“网络爬取”,常被用于爬取数据或处理网络资源。在Python编程语言中,使用各种爬虫框架或库可以很方便地编写出自己的爬虫程序。
二、为什么使用Python进行爬虫?
Python的语法简单易读,上手速度快,这使得开发者能够更快地开发出复杂的程序。另外,Python有着非常丰富的第三方库,其中不乏优秀的爬虫框架,如Scrapy和BeautifulSoup等。再者,Python在数据处理和数据分析方面也有着非常强大的能力,可以很好地处理爬取到的数据。
三、如何编写Python爬虫?
确定目标网站:在开始编写爬虫之前,需要先确定要爬取的网站和需要的数据类型。
分析网站结构:通过分析目标网站的HTML代码结构,找出要爬取数据的URL地址以及相关标签等信息。
选择合适的爬虫框架和库:选择合适的爬虫框架和库是成功开发一个好的爬虫的重要前提。比如使用Scrapy框架来创建程序的结构,以及使用BeautifulSoup库来解析HTML等。
编写代码:根据网站结构和目标数据编写相应的代码来提取需要的数据。这需要有一定的HTML和Python编程基础。
保存数据:将提取的数据保存到本地文件或数据库中以备后续使用。
四、注意事项
在编写和使用爬虫时,需要遵守相关法律法规和网站规定,尊重网站的版权和隐私权。同时也要注意不要对目标网站造成过大的负载压力,以免影响其正常运行。
以上就是关于Python爬虫的一些基础知识和实践技巧的简要介绍。通过掌握这些知识,我们可以更有效地收集和处理数据,提高工作效率。同时也要注意在使用爬虫时遵守相关法律法规和道德规范。
label :
- Python爬虫
- 网络爬取
- 爬虫框架
- Scrapy
- BeautifulSoup
- 数据处理
- 遵循法律法规